Rotary District 3450 PPE Seminar

The District PPE Seminar 2025-26 was successfully held on August 16 at The Hong Kong Federation of Youth Groups Jockey Club Media 21 (M21). Nearly 90 District leaders, Rotary members, and guests gathered to witness Rotary’s unwavering commitment to promoting environmental protection and sustainable development.

The event commenced with a welcoming speech by PP Wendy Lee, Chair of the District PPE Committee. This was followed by the screening of the two documentaries The Color of Ice and highlights of a report on the Tianshan glaciers in Xinjiang, sparking profound reflection among attendees on the global climate crisis.

The seminar featured renowned polar explorer Dr. Rebecca Lee Lok Sze, who shared her valuable polar expedition experiences; Followed by the two guest speakers from the Jockey Club Museum of Climate Change (MOCC), Chinese University of Hong Kong, Dr. Felix Leung, who discussed actionable strategies for Hong Kong people to address climate change; and Mr. K.C. Wong introduced the museum’s educational initiatives in glacier conservation. The presentations were both insightful and inspiring.

Dr. Matthew Chan also shared successful SDG project cases and highlighted the “Let the Glacier Cool” initiative, as well as the upcoming Rotary D3450 Sichuan Dagu Glacier Tour in October. The symbolic “Let the Glaciers Shine Again” ceremony followed, led by District Governor DG Cassy Cheng, where guests lit glacier cups to symbolize Rotary’s united determination to protect the planet. She expressed her heartfelt thanks to the guests speakers and encouraged all the Rotarians to join the Sichuan Dagu Glacier Tour.

The event concluded with Chair PP Wendy Lee introducing other exciting activities and program previews for this year’s PPE initiatives. She encouraged everyone to stay tuned for detailed updates via the PPE webpage, group chats, and social media channels.
